BEIJING (AFP): Chinese authorities on Monday (Feb 24) slightly relaxed their month-long quarantine measures in Wuhan, allowing some people to leave the epicentre of the country's virus epidemic under certain conditions.
The city of 11 million has been under lockdown since Jan 23 after authorities shut down transport links into and out of the city in an effort to contain the new coronavirus outbreak.
